FOOD FOR THOUGHT:

“The mobile phone was the most popular device used to access the Internet wirelessly, away from the home or workplace, with just under a third (31 per cent) of Internet users connecting this way. The adoption of mobile phone technology is being led by 16 to 24-year-old Internet users, with 44 per cent using a mobile phone to access the Internet.“

Office for National StatisticsStatistical Bulletin: Internet Access August 2010 http://www.statistics.gov.uk/pdfdir/iahi0810.pdf

Initial idea tweaked

•iPad app quotes range from £2k - £20k……

•Feet back on the ground

•Tablets = new technology = new / small market

•Smartphones = current technology = large / expanding market

•As useful for marketing as for accessing resources

•Marketing feature ideas added

• Contact Page

• Course Directory

• NNC Blog (RSS Feed)

•Money raised through ILT budget

•Bids submitted for tender through contacts on appideas website

Page 7: Developing an institutional mobile application

Our first app

•Tender offered to Swanify end of July 2010 (www.swanify.com)

•First draft submitted end of August 2010 - http://screenr.com/pOr

•Changes made by mid September 2010 - http://screenr.com/5cn

•Payment made October 2010

•Final design submitted to App store end of October 2010

•Available to download early November 2010

•Over 250 downloads by February 2011

•New part time course guide added January 2011 (£75)

•New full time guide added May 2011 (£100)

•Over 500 downloads to date, with little marketing

New NNC App

•Proposal submitted May 2011

•Estimated time set by developers = 6 weeks

•Development commenced May 2011 onwards

•NNC Goalposts changing!

•First draft of template June 2011

•Configuring of internal XML July 2011

•NNC Rebranding October 2011

•NNC ‘flirting with various features’ Summer 2011-March 2012

•Change of template to suit branding April 2012

•Submission to App store May 2012

•Live June 2012 (Apple only, others to follow)
